Latifi admits 2022 could be last season in F1
Jul.1 Nicholas Latifi has admitted that 2022 could be his last season in Formula 1. However, the Canadian driver noted that rumours he would be ousted by Williams for poor performance after his recent home race in Montreal were side of the mark. 'Rumours and criticism are part of the game,' he told RTL at Silverstone. 'But if you believe everything that is written, my season would have been over after Montreal. 'We'll stick to the facts. Tomorrow we'll talk to Jost Capito,' he added, referring to Williams' team boss.
